Microwave oven transformers (MOTs) are often used in high-voltage experiments and as components in various electrical projects. They are sometimes referred to as "good traps" due to their effectiveness in certain applications. Here are a few reasons why MOTs are considered useful:

  1. High voltage output: MOTs are designed to convert standard household voltage (e.g., 120 or 240 volts) into a much higher voltage, typically around 2,000 to 3,000 volts. This high voltage output makes them suitable for applications that require a significant electrical potential, such as powering particle accelerators or creating high-voltage arcs.

  2. Compact and robust design: MOTs are constructed to be compact, robust, and capable of handling high currents. They consist of a primary winding, a secondary winding, and a ferromagnetic core. This design allows them to withstand the electrical stresses and high temperatures associated with microwave oven operation.

  3. Availability and affordability: Microwave ovens are commonly found in households, making MOTs relatively easy to obtain. Compared to specialized high-voltage transformers, MOTs are often more affordable and accessible, making them a popular choice for hobbyists and experimenters.

  4. Isolation and safety: MOTs offer a level of isolation between the primary and secondary windings, providing safety benefits. The high-voltage secondary winding is typically well-insulated and electrically isolated from the primary winding and the input power source. This isolation helps prevent electrical shocks and protects sensitive equipment.

  5. Well-defined characteristics: MOTs have well-defined electrical characteristics, making them predictable in terms of voltage output and current capabilities. This predictability allows experimenters to design and control electrical circuits with more precision.

However, it's important to note that working with MOTs can be dangerous due to the high voltages involved. They should only be handled by individuals with the necessary knowledge and experience in electrical safety. Safety precautions such as proper insulation, grounding, and following electrical codes and guidelines should always be observed when using MOTs or any high-voltage equipment.
